Abstract
The present invention provides a kind of environment-friendly type treegarden irrigation device, is related to garden equipment technical field.The environment-friendly type treegarden irrigation device, including bottom plate, rotating electric machine is fixedly installed at the top of the bottom plate, Rotational Cylindrical is fixedly installed at the top of the rotating electric machine, circular mounting plate is fixedly installed at the top of the Rotational Cylindrical, annular groove is offered at the top of the bottom plate, the quantity of the annular groove is two, and the inside of two annular grooves is provided with ring slider.The environment-friendly type treegarden irrigation device, pass through the cooperation of inlet, header tank, separate mesh, the first filter screen and active carbon purifying plate, when rainy season, rainwater is collected by inlet, rainwater is flowed into header tank by separate mesh, and the rainwater of inflow passes through the first filter screen filtration first, and the bottom inside header tank is then entered by active carbon purifying plate, the device can use that treated rainwater or slightly-polluted water irrigate vegetation, have effectively saved the resource of tap water.

Working principle:In use, matching by inlet, header tank, separate mesh, the first filter screen and active carbon purifying plate
It closes, when rainy season, rainwater is collected by inlet, rainwater is flowed into header tank by separate mesh, and the rainwater of inflow passes through first
Then first filter screen filtration enters the bottom inside header tank by active carbon purifying plate, will be slight dirty when normal weather
The water of dye is discharged into inside header tank by inlet, by the cooperation of solar panels and battery, in fine day, too by collection
Sun can be converted to electric energy and be stored in battery, by the cooperation of support column, wheel carrier, push and pull bar, card wheel block and wheel, lead to
It crosses push and pull bar and wheel and irrigator is shifted onto the place for needing to irrigate, then wheel is blocked by card wheel block, is then passed through
Communicating pipe, controlled valve, water storage box, the second filter screen, immersible pump, hose, Pipe jointer, high-pressure water pipe and high-pressure nozzle are matched
It closes, opens the controlled valve on communicating pipe, rainwater or slightly-polluted water are by being put into storage communicating pipe after filtering in header tank
In water tank, start immersible pump, immersible pump will discharge into water in water storage box and absorb by suction hose, and be transported to by water outlet soft
In water pipe, irrigation water spray is then carried out by the vegetation that high-pressure water pipe and high-pressure nozzle irrigate needs, when irrigation vegetation height
When inconsistent, by the cooperation of driving motor, rotation axis, gear, tooth plate, Pipe jointer, strut and slide bar, start driving motor band
Moving gear rotation, gear band moving tooth plate is mobile, and strut is slided on slide bar simultaneously, and the Pipe jointer for being fixedly mounted on tooth plate is same
Shi Yidong, high-pressure nozzle are moved in watering trough, when irrigated area range is bigger, by rotating electric machine, Rotational Cylindrical,
The cooperation of annular groove, ring slider, connecting column and circular mounting plate, starts rotating electric machine, and Rotational Cylindrical drives circular mounting plate
It is rotated, while the ring slider for being fixedly mounted on connection column bottom is rotated in annular groove.
